Latin America and the Caribbean: Helicopter Market 2025

Helicopter Market Size in Latin America and the Caribbean

The Latin American helicopter market contracted notably to $X in 2022, reducing by -24.2% against the previous year. Overall, consumption recorded a pronounced descent. The level of consumption peaked at $X in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2022, consumption failed to regain momentum.

Helicopter Production in Latin America and the Caribbean

In value terms, helicopter production stood at $X in 2022 estimated in export price. The total output value increased at an average annual rate of +1.2% from 2012 to 2022; the trend pattern remained relatively stable, with only minor fluctuations being observed throughout the analyzed period.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when the production volume increased by 17% against the previous year. As a result, production reached the peak level of $X. From 2018 to 2022, production growth remained at a lower figure.

Helicopter Exports

Exports in Latin America and the Caribbean

In 2022, the amount of civil helicopters exported in Latin America and the Caribbean soared to X units, rising by 397% against 2021. In general, exports continue to indicate significant growth.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2015 with an increase of 4,047%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ports reached the peak figure at X units in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, the ex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.

In value terms, helicopter exports reduced slightly to $X in 2022. Overall, exports, however, saw a abrupt desc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 when exports increased by 91%.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$X. From 2017 to 2022,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.

Exports by Country

Bolivia prevails in exports structure, reaching X units, which was near 95% of total exports in 2022. Mexico (X units) took a little share of total exports.

Bolivia was also the fastest-growing in terms of the civil helicopters exports, with a CAGR of +114.4% from 2012 to 2022. At the same time, Mexico (+3.8%) displayed positive paces of growth. From 2012 to 2022, the share of Bolivia increased by +94 percentage points.

In value terms, Mexico ($X) remains the largest helicopter supplier in Latin America and the Caribbean, comprising 10%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Bolivia ($X), with a 2.9% share of total exports.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value in Mexico amounted to -9.2%.

Export Prices by Country

The export price in Latin America and the Caribbean stood at $X per unit in 2022, with a decrease of -80.7% against the previous year. Overall, the export price saw a precipitous set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when the export price increased by 800% against the previous year. The level of export peaked at $X per unit in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, the export prices remained at a lower figure.

There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major exporting countries.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Mexico ($X per unit), while Bolivia amounted to $X per unit.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Mexico (-12.5%).

Helicopter Imports

Imports in Latin America and the Caribbean

In 2022, overseas purchases of civil helicopters increased by 13% to X units, rising for the second consecutive year after two years of decline. Overall, imports, however, showed a deep reduction.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 172% against the previous year. The volume of import peaked at X units in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, imports failed to regain momentum.

In value terms, helicopter imports rose to $X in 2022. In general, imports, however, saw a deep reduction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 81%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um at $X in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2022, imports remained at a lower figure.

Imports by Country

Brazil prevails in imports structure, resulting at X units, which was near 89% of total imports in 2022. It was distantly followed by Mexico (X units), generating a 7.2% share of total imports.

From 2012 to 2022, average annual rates of growth with regard to helicopter imports into Brazil stood at -11.1%. At the same time, Mexico (+27.2%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Mexico emerged as the fastest-growing importer imported in Latin America and the Caribbean, with a CAGR of +27.2% from 2012-2022. While the share of Mexico (+7 p.p.) increased significantly in terms of the total imports from 2012-2022, the share of Brazil (-9.6 p.p.) displayed negative dynamics.

In value terms, Brazil ($X) constitutes the largest market for imported civil helicopters in Latin America and the Caribbean, comprising 40%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Mexico ($X), with a 0.7% share of total imports.

In Brazil, helicopter imports shrank by an average annual rate of -11.3% over the period from 2012-2022.

Import Prices by Country

The import price in Latin America and the Caribbean stood at $X per unit in 2022, falling by -9.8%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price, however, continues to indicate temperate grow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2015 when the import price increased by 88%. Over the period under review, import prices attained the peak figure at $X per unit in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.

There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major importing count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Brazil ($X per unit), while Mexico totaled $X per unit.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Brazil (-0.3%).
